To care for Japanese ferns, provide them with indirect light, consistent moisture, and well-draining soil. Keep the soil evenly moist but not waterlogged, and avoid letting it dry out completely. Mist the leaves regularly to maintain humidity. Fertilize sparingly and prune any dead or yellowing fronds. Protect them from drafts and extreme temperatures.

Water ZZ plants every 2-3 weeks to keep them thriving and healthy. Overwatering can harm the plant, so it's important to let the soil dry out between waterings.
To care for potted geraniums, place them in a sunny spot, water them regularly but allow the soil to dry out between waterings, fertilize them every few weeks, and prune them to encourage new growth. Keep an eye out for pests and diseases, and repot them as needed to ensure they thrive and stay healthy.

Water pitcher plants once a week, ensuring the soil is consistently moist but not waterlogged. Adjust frequency based on environmental conditions such as temperature and humidity.
